Former Home Minister Ramesh Lekhak to Appear Before Investigation Commission Today
Kathmandu — Former Home Minister and Nepali Congress leader Ramesh Lekhak is scheduled to appear before the Investigation Commission on Monday to record his statement.
He will visit the office of the Investigation Commission formed under the 2082 Act at 12 noon today to provide information regarding the incidents that occurred on Bhadra 23 and 24.
On the same day, at 2:00 PM, former Home Minister Lekhak will also publicly present his views through the media at the Nepali Congress Parliamentary Party office in Singha Durbar.
The Investigation Commission, formed to probe the incidents of Bhadra 23 and 24, had formally summoned then Home Minister Lekhak to record his statement.
